Well, you might know me as a mod over on that there forum being discussed. Only since March, mind you, but nevertheless ...

The most recent thread disappearance started like this ... I got a PM from the accident pilot asking that the thread be removed as he/she was still "recovering". I told that person that I would pull it for the time being, but no more than a week, and would have to discuss with the other mods. Other mods received some PMs suggesting that there was reason to leave the thread for discussion and so it was returned to service, so to speak. In the meantime, someone had posted a "what happened to the thread" thread. Then it disappeared with no trace in the logs. My guess is that admin received a PM, maybe even a lawyered up PM, demanding removal. The rest of the mods don't know what happened to that thread. Admin has no obligation to tell us, but may do so when he gets a chance.

Other threads referenced here which have disappeared have gone because someone did, in fact, lawyer up. AvCanada does not have the money to fight in court for the words of anonymous users who may not even have their stories straight.

AvCanada has a different moderation style, to be sure, than Pprune. Not better or worse, but different.
